    The aim of this study was to investigate the possible role of multiple inherited thrombophilic gene variations in women with unexplained spontaneous abortions. For this purpose, the Factor V Leiden (FVL) (rs6025), Prothrombin G20210A (rs1799963), MTHFR C677T (rs1801133), PAI-1 4G/5G (rs1799889), ACE I/D (rs1799752), eNOS E298D (rs1799983), and Apo E E2/E3/E4 (rs429358) polymorphisms were genotyped and correlated in spontaneously aborted fetal materials, their mothers and fertile women. Twenty three abortion materials, 22 women with ≥1 unexplained fetal loss, and 22 control subjects with at least two healthy term infants as a control group were studied. Target SNPs for each gene were analyzed by real time-PCR technique after genomic DNA isolation from maternal blood-EDTA, control group blood-EDTA and spontaneously aborted fetal tissues. Some cases had a single thrombophilic polymorphism, but the rest of the patients and fetal materials had combined thrombophilic polymorphisms. The PAI-1 4G/5G+4G/4G (P= 0.0017), 4G/4G (P= 0.0253), eNOS 894GT+894TT (P=0.0011) genotypes and T allele (P=0.0185), Apo E E3/E4+E3/E2+E2/E4 (P<0.0001) genotypes, E2 (P<0.0001) and E4 (P<0.0001) alleles were higher in spontaneously aborted fetal materials when compared to their mothers and control group. The Factor V Leiden rs6025, Prothrombin G20210A, MTHFR C677T, ACE I/D genotypes were different for each group but not statistically significant due to relatively small size of the samples (P>0.05). Our results indicated that combined thrombophilic gene variations may be associated with increased risk for spontaneous abortions and results need to be confirmed by larger sample size.

    Background VEGF gene has been reported to be related with many diseases and recurrent pregnancy loss in various studies. VEGF polymorphisms are risk factors for pregnancy losses، and generally studies report only women’s genetic analyses. To evaluate the association between VEGF A C405G، C460T، C936T and C2578A polymorphisms and spontaneous abortion، we studied the genotypes of spontaneously aborted fetuses، their mothers and healthy control cases. Methods 23 spontaneously aborted fetal materials، 22 mothers who had these abortions and 86 healthy control cases included to this study. VEGF A C405G، C460T، C936T and C2578A polymorphisms are analysed by Real Time PCR technique after genomic DNA isolation from all samples. Results VEGF A +405GG genotype and +405G allele were higher in fetuses comparing both with mothers and healthy control group. VEGF A +936TT genotype and +936T allele were higher in fetuses comparing with mothers. VEGF A +460C/T polymorphism CT and TT genotypes were higher in fetuses comparing with mothers. Conclusions We ascertained that VEGF A +405C/G، +460C/T، and +936C/T polymorphisms are risk factors for spontaneous abortion in fetal genotypes comparing with their mothers and healthy control cases.
